Adrian Bell's Men And The Fields paints a vivid pastoral portrait of rural life in England, capturing the rhythms and realities of agricultural existence. This evocative work of non-fiction chronicles the daily routines, seasonal changes, and enduring spirit of the men who work the land. Bell presents a deeply personal and reflective account, illustrating the profound connection between humanity and nature. The narrative offers a tranquil yet insightful look into a world shaped by tradition and the earth's demands, revealing the quiet dignity and resilience inherent in farming communities.
